Kanye West Compares Himself to Hitler
photo

Halfway through his set at the Big Chill Festival in England, on August 7, Kanye West proclaimed that he was more hated than Adolf Hitler.

During his seven-minute, auto-tuned monologue, West took self-loathing to a whole new level, “I walk through the hotel and I walk down the street and people look at me like I’m f—-ing insane, like I’m Hitler,” West continued, “One day the light will shine through and one day people will understand everything I ever did.”

The rapper also defended some of his most controversial moments, including crashing the stage at the MTV Europe Music Awards in 2006, and his ‘misogynistic’ “Monster” music video.

Before continuing his set, West told the audience, “There’s so much bulls—t going on in music right now and somebody has to make a f—-ing difference.”
